										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img decoding="async" class="alignleft wp-image-4931 size-medium" title="The impact of Lotus Notes sale on users and the future of content management" src="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2019/01/The-impact-of-Lotus-Notes-sale-on-users-and-the-future-of-content-management-450x450.jpg" alt="The impact of Lotus Notes sale on users and the future of content management" width="450" height="450" srcset="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2019/01/The-impact-of-Lotus-Notes-sale-on-users-and-the-future-of-content-management-450x450.jpg 450w, https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2019/01/The-impact-of-Lotus-Notes-sale-on-users-and-the-future-of-content-management-150x150.jpg 150w, https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2019/01/The-impact-of-Lotus-Notes-sale-on-users-and-the-future-of-content-management.jpg 800w" sizes="(max-width: 450px) 100vw, 450px" />There’s no doubt that <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2011/10/is-lotus-notes-still-here-to-stay/">Lotus Notes</a> customers are nervous, after IBM’s announcement, regarding the sale of the software. On the other side, this is the best moment for them to reconsider their options and see if it’s time for a change.</p>
<p>Last month, <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/01/ibm-forms-strategic-new-partnership-domino/">IBM</a> revealed that everything that’s left of Lotus – including <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Lotus Notes, Domino</a>, and Portal – will be sold to India-based company <a target="_blank" r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/HCL_Technologies">HCL technologies</a>, in a deal worth $1.8 billion. And the reason behind their decision was rather simple: even with some big investments, platforms like Lotus Notes will still lack a lot of the features that are nowadays present in modern enterprise content management systems, as well as content services platforms.</p>
<p>However, it’s worth mentioning that Lotus Notes, for example, was designed in a different era, so the only way to compete with the functionality of newer enterprise content management systems or content services platforms would’ve been to come with something completely new, but use the same name. Still, this requires big investments, which can be intimidating, even for successful companies.</p>
<p><b>Ok, so what’s next for users? </b></p>
<p>Technically, there is some good news! It appears that HCL Technologies is planning to invest into Lotus Notes more than <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2012/04/ibm-find-businesses-slow-on-uptake-of-cloud-computing/">IBM</a> did, as soon as some of its biggest issues will be solved. In this case, users who remain faithful have a limited number of options at the moment.</p>
<p><b>Wait until the transition is complete</b></p>
<p>It is still unknown what are HCL Technologies’ exact plans for <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Lotus Notes</a>, but they will definitely put some money into it. In this case, users can choose to stick it out. Sure, there will be some bumps along the road, but there’s no way HCL will abandon the project.</p>
<p>At the moment, since there is no backing from <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/ibm/">IBM</a>, a lot of developers might feel like abandoning everything, creating a sizeable maintenance risk, but we can’t say that this was unexpected.</p>
<p><b>Switch to another on-premise Document Management System</b></p>
<p>If you’ve been using Notes for some time but don’t trust HCL’s abilities to take over the management, it’s obvious that you will start looking for another option. And this is what a lot of people will probably do, as they will want a newer and more modern on-premise document management system.</p>
<p>Sure, this can be a big undertaking, as it presumes migrating files. Still, it will also help minimize any disruptions or service gaps, not to mention that it can provide additional capabilities that the ones currently available with Lotus Notes.</p>
<p><b>Move files to a cloud-based Content Services Platform</b></p>
<p>Considering that cloud-based content services platforms, as well as ECMs are very easy to adopt, thanks to the significant advances in cloud software technology and infrastructure, this can be a viable solution for any <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Lotus Notes</a> users. Still, before doing this, they need to make sure that their platform of choice can meet the same requirements.</p>
<p>The differences between most cloud-based ECMs and Lotus Notes are significant, so long-time users can even have a shock at first. On the other side, they have significantly smaller infrastructure requirements, not to mention that they are cheaper to implement.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="alignleft wp-image-4898" title="Domino version 10, to revamp the entire platform" src="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/11/Domino-version-10-to-revamp-the-entire-platform.jpg" alt="Domino version 10, to revamp the entire platform" width="450" height="450" srcset="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/11/Domino-version-10-to-revamp-the-entire-platform.jpg 800w, https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/11/Domino-version-10-to-revamp-the-entire-platform-450x450.jpg 450w, https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/11/Domino-version-10-to-revamp-the-entire-platform-150x150.jpg 150w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 450px) 100vw, 450px" />Nowadays, <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/ibm/">IBM</a> is doing everything they can in order to keep Domino, as a 29-year-old platform, as relevant as possible to modern app developers and IT shops. However, there are some big changes ahead, which can significantly change the entire platform!</p>
<p>Ever since 2013, no significant update was released, but the upcoming <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Domino version 10</a>, which is expected to include the Verse collaboration tool, using analytics to help a user decide which email messages are a priority, but also the Sametime collaboration tool, considered a competitor for Slack and Microsoft Teams.</p>
<p>Domino 10 is expected to offer improved mobile capabilities, but also feature a broader cross-language compatibility, as well as support for the CentOS operating system, allowing users to create Docker containers, whether on-premises or in the club.</p>
<p>But this is not it, since the next update will bring much more!</p>
<p>IBM Domino Mobile Apps is a client-based application, currently in a beta stage, which allows developers to create apps – for executives and remote users – compatible with <a target="_blank" r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IPad">iPads</a>, with no additional programming efforts. And this will be great news for a lot of users, as adding iPad support for mobile users is one of the oldest demands of the community!</p>
<p>After the update, corporate developers will be able to enhance their applications with the ability to access the tablet’s GPS and camera, not to mention that they can use already existing <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/apps/">Domino apps</a> to work both online and offline, no matter the location, and sidestep a lack of connectivity.</p>
<p>As a side note, Domino version 10 is compatible with JavaScript, so developers can integrate and put together new apps relying on <a target="_blank" r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IBM_Notes">Domino</a> data, but also on any available REST APIs that reside on a full, web-based software stack. And these are just a few of the new features we’re looking forward to seeing!</p>
<p>“In terms of our future vision, we recognize that people want to do full-stack development, but they also want to do all the other stuff they have been doing since 1989,” said <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/ibm/">IBM</a> Domino’s Andrew Manby. “This is to say they want to build and implement applications quickly. There is a huge space for us now around low code to do just that – something we have been doing for decades.”</p>
<p>Unfortunately for artificial intelligence and machine learning enthusiasts, Domino version 10 won’t be focusing that much on these two concepts, but the same Andre Manby says that we should expect to see them in later versions, in order to aid developers to build various information repositories, useful for <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2010/12/it-support-tampa-for-small-business/">support</a> scenarios.</p>
<p>“It would be very easy for us to add AI and cognitive for searching data, especially since we added JavaScript, and also how <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Domino</a> works with [IBM] Connections and other parts of the Watson portfolio,” he added.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="alignleft wp-image-4890" title="Top 3 Cloud Computing Services you can currently rely on" src="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/10/Top_3_Cloud_Computing_Services_you_can_currently_rely_on.jpg" alt="Cloud Computing Services you can currently rely on" width="450" height="450" srcset="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/10/Top_3_Cloud_Computing_Services_you_can_currently_rely_on.jpg 600w, https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/10/Top_3_Cloud_Computing_Services_you_can_currently_rely_on-450x450.jpg 450w, https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/10/Top_3_Cloud_Computing_Services_you_can_currently_rely_on-150x150.jpg 150w" sizes="auto, (max-width: 450px) 100vw, 450px" />Nowadays, <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/technology/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">technology</a> is evolving blazing fast and despite what some people are saying about this, mentioning all kinds of negative effects, we are nothing but grateful for this. And small business owners are just a category that shares the same sentiment, when it comes to reducing operating costs.</p>
<p>Previously, they were basically forced to buy and maintain their own physical servers, but now, thanks to the concept of cloud computing, which consists in companies offering a part of their data centers’ processing power for a fee, small companies can now get started way more quickly and inexpensively.</p>
<p>Still, picking the best service of this type can be a real challenge, especially if it’s a relatively new concept for you. But this is what we’re here for!</p>
<p>Below you can find a short list with three of the best – at least for us – cloud computing services available on the market right now, including their main pros and cons.</p>
<p><b>Rackspace Cloud</b></p>
<p>Rackspace Cloud allows you to choose a provider and easily interact with it using their own platform. Until now, they have partnerships with major providers, such as <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/06/microsoft-azure-cloud-computing-platform-services/">Microsoft Azure</a>, Amazon Web Services and VMware. We can talk about a major advantage here: the scalability of some of the biggest cloud providers of the moment, combined with the customer support of a small company.</p>
<p>Currently, you can choose from public cloud, private cloud, hybrid cloud, as well as multi-cloud. For us, the public cloud option seems to be the most reliable one, as it provides quick and easy access to all the <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/it-support/">IT</a> resources you need, shrinking the cost of data center management. Still, private cloud can also be a great choice, with faster servers.</p>
<p>You can now sign up for free to Rackspace Cloud and give their services a try.</p>
<p><b>Google Cloud</b></p>
<p>When it comes to the big players in the cloud computing game, Google Cloud seems to be one of the best options, especially because it offers a 12-month free trial. Sure, the setup can be a bit tricky at first, but once you get through it, you will enjoy its benefits.</p>
<p>The platform itself allows users to create <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/business/">business</a> solutions using Google’s modular web services and includes a multi-layered secure infrastructure, meaning that anything you build or store will be 100% safe.</p>
<p><a target="_blank" r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Google_Cloud_Platform">Google Cloud</a> includes a variety of tools as well, ensuring constant performance and management, like Compute Engine, App Engine, Container Engine, Cloud Storage and Big Query.</p>
<p><b>IBM Cloud</b></p>
<p>Tech giant IBM is, at least for us, the most complete cloud computing solution of the moment. IBM Cloud offers a wide range of services, covering both virtual and hardware-based servers, consisting in public, private and management networks.</p>
<p>The user has complete infrastructure control, as the ‘bare metal’ hardware servers provide sole access to the entire server, reducing the so-called ‘noisy neighbor’ effect, but also seriously improving performance. Also, it’s worth mentioning that the IBM cloud computing solution can be managed by a single system, controller through a web portal, <a target="_blank" r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Application_programming_interface">API</a> or even <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/apps/">mobile apps</a>.</p>
<p>By far, the best way to start with <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2012/04/ibm-find-businesses-slow-on-uptake-of-cloud-computing/">IBM Cloud</a> is by picking the Lite tier, without a time limit and no credit card details. This includes 256MB of Cloud Foundry Memory and also offering the possibility to upgrade, after using the calculator to estimate future costs. Oh, and they also offer tailored packages, depending on your needs.</p>

Second beta of version 10 is imminent" width="450" height="450" />As previously reported, the folks over at IBM are doing their best in an attempt to make the Notes/Domino platform futureproof. In this direction, they are preparing to launch a second beta of the new version, 10, for the upcoming days.</p>
<p>For those of you who aren’t familiar with <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Lotus Notes</a>, it’s mainly an environment for messaging and app development, acquired by IBM for a then-record fee of $3 billion. In the meantime, the original Notes platform was rebranded as <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Domino</a>, while the actual Notes name was kept for the client. However, as soon as <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/outlook/">Microsoft’s Outlook</a> was introduced, the enthusiasm around Domino faded.</p>
<p>Back to the present days, there is a whole new roadmap now, promising to deliver a new version of Lotus Notes in 2018, as well as another one in 2019. As for the one we’re getting soon, it’s absolutely loaded with goodies!</p>
<p>Over the past weeks, the <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/04/ibm-strongly-feels-that-domino-and-lotus-notes-will-find-its-success-again/">IBM</a> staff toured across Asia, explaining crowds what they should expect from Domino 10, currently available as a closed Beta. And since you’re all looking forward to knowing when it will go live, IBM collaboration executive Mat Newman revealed that a second beta will be available by the end of July 2018.</p>
<p>Specifically, this beta will offer the possibility to test <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/07/meet-domino-the-new-but-not-so-new-collaboration-platform/">Domino</a> (for Windows and Linux), the Notes client (for Windows and Mac), Notes, Designer and Admin clients (for <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2010/10/windows-essential-business-server-has-been-dicontinued/">Windows</a>), Verse on Premises (for Windows and Linux) and, finally, the DominoDB NPM package for Node.js.</p>
<p>Obviously, the latter is the most important item, considering that one of the main reasons why Lotus Notes didn’t manage to “shine” was because the development environment was pretty much a silo. Therefore, integrating Node.js will transform it and give users the possibility to come up with more modern and portable apps.</p>
<p>But this is not everything…</p>
<p>Verse on Premises is another thing we’re looking forward to, as it’s considered IBM’s attempt at creating a new and sleek collaboration tool that relies on analytics to help discover the messages that need attention.</p>
<p>Besides this, we’re also waiting to see IBM’s multimedia and instant messaging collaboration tool, expected by Domino shops who just don’t want to be left behind by Slack or Microsoft Team users.</p>
<p>Finally, we should mention the fact that there are actually way more features to be launched with this new version, including tablet <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/it-support/">support</a>, Docker images, as well as telemetry readable by New Relic. All these can take Lotus Notes to the same level as many other modern <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/apps/">applications</a>.</p>
<p>As for Domino 11, it’s expected to make its debut in 2019, promising to bring a low-code development environment, similar to what <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2011/01/ken-moore-leaves-for-oracle/">Oracle</a>, Salesforce and ServiceNow are already doing.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="alignleft wp-image-1710 size-medium" title="Meet Domino, the New but not so New Collaboration Platform" src="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/07/Meet-Domino-the-new-but-not-so-new-collaboration-platform-450x450.jpg" alt="IB Systems - Meet Domino, the New but not so New Collaboration Platform" width="450" height="450" />For the last five years, <a target="_blank"   r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IBM_Notes">IBM’s Domino</a> client-server platform seemed forgotten by developers and everybody else, as there was no major release since 9.0 Social Edition. There were a few minor updates, however, broken down into feature packs and interim features, but nothing else able to make its users stick to it. And when they thought that it’s all over, something surprising happened!</span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">Domino’s both development and support business was bought by Indian service company HCL, currently looking forward to building its own enterprise software business. As a side note, they have already acquired multiple IBM products as well, from which we mention Informix or the Rational portfolio. As for Domino, it’s expected to receive a well-needed breath of fresh air.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">After the deal was completed, 300+ developers, as well as specialists, moved from IBM to HCL, not to mention that the company is planning to bring new members to its team.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">Even more, they have made a couple of very important additions, like Jason Gary, a developer slowed down by IBM management in the past, who was appointed as Chief Technology Officer, and Richard Jefts, as general manager and vice president of Collaborative Workflow Platforms.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">The two, alongside IBM offering manager Andrew Manby and worldwide sales responsible Uffe Sorensen recently gave an interview for Heise Online, talking about the company’s plans for the near future.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">They managed to cover the platform’s strengths and minuses, but also the prospect of releasing a new version this fall &#8211; 10 -, while 2019 should bring us version 11.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">Shortly after HCL managed to prove that Domino is back in the lead, the entire team decided that it’s time to actually start business again. Jason Gary is now planning to run it into multiple containers, so that specific, individual parts of it can be outsourced as open source, while other parts will be added in time. And this is not everything!</span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">The plan is to also rewrite and modernize all their application development tools, so they can allow apps to be re-engineered by users. The existing Domino Designer can be considered overloaded, as not even the most experienced developers can be expected.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">Finally, Domino will eventually be extended by Node.js, allowing Javascript applications based on Domino to run.</span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">India-based HCL announced that they will prioritize customer requirements using the so-called # <a target="_blank"   r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://ibm.com/collaboration/ibm-domino">domino2025 jams</a>. As a side note, in the past, Domino was pushed through by special requirements of some key accounts with a corresponding pressure on the sellers, but from now on, things will change. </span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">HCL wants to listen to all customers, in order to prioritize the new features. In this direction, the first round of jams took place in December 2017, while the next one is scheduled for the fall.</span></span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000;"><span style="font-family: Arial, serif;">Sure, there are a lot of plans right now and everybody seems enthusiastic, as the team is hungry for success and want to bring the old <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2016/12/the-past-present-and-future-of-lotus-notes/">Lotus Notes</a> &#8211; even though it has a new name &#8211; back to live again. But this won’t be easy, as their main mission will be to convince the customers that after a long waiting period, they can once again rely on the client. Also, the big test will happen after sales stabilize, as they’re looking forward to seeing if customers will write new applications with <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/04/ibm-strongly-feels-that-domino-and-lotus-notes-will-find-its-success-again/">Domino</a> again.</span></span></p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="alignleft wp-image-1643 size-medium" title="IBM strongly feels that Domino and Lotus Notes will find its success again" src="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/04/IBM-strongly-feels-that-Domino-and-Lotus-Notes-will-find-its-success-again-450x450.jpg" alt="Domino and Lotus Notes will find its success again" width="450" height="450" /><a target="_blank"   r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IBM_Notes">IBM</a> is very confident that its proprietary computerized applications ‘Domino’ and ‘Lotus Notes’ will again become relevant to their steadfast users, thanks to its signing a deal with <a target="_blank"   r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/HCL_Technologies">HCL</a>. Both HCL and ‘Big Blue’ have finalized developmental plans for Notes/Domino package. Since the day IBM disclosed that the Indian IT major would oversee onward development of the former’s groupware, both companies have organized an extensive tour comprising a total of 22 brick-and-mortar conferences and four webinars.</p>
<p>The minutes of the conclaves that witnessed the congregation of about 2000 people coupled with findings of the experimentations in the lab were shared with loyal customers and users of Lotus Notes. The idea conveyed to the faithful users was that HCL as well as IBM strongly felt that Notes was poised for a comeback and retrieve its lost glory. Both conglomerates were of the opinion that the application portfolio, following a revamp, would once again come in handy for solving teamwork-oriented business problems.</p>
<p>Company executives of Big Blue and HCL revealed that the 10th edition of <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/lotus-notes-developer-lotus-notes-support/">Lotus Notes</a> which will be unveiled sometime in 2018 will mark the beginning step in achieving the above goal. Participants in a particular webinar were informed that the 11th version of the software was already in the planning stages. The firms also announced that they had a lot of catching up to do before the ultimate objective could be on the path of realization.</p>
<p>Webinar attendees were updated that version 10 was actually the first step in the strategy or tactical approach undertaken to make the ‘Domino 2025’ groupware fully operational. ‘<a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/01/ibm-forms-strategic-new-partnership-domino/">Domino 2025</a>’ was expected to offer users an unprecedented and unparalleled first-rate mailing experience. Technicians are also working on making Notes fully compatible with mobile devices, for customized <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/apps/">apps</a> as well as mails. Making the application suitable for chats across the net and loading an intuitive team calendar were also on the cards.</p>
<p>Users have been also been updated on arrangements on releasing the apps and about plans on developing apps exclusively for iPads. Attendees who attended the conferences organized in different venues had forwarded their pleas for enhancing scalability of the applications portfolio. Therefore, the professionals now have one more aspect to fine-tune and they will soon be taking this up as well.</p>
<p>Web designers and developers have been assured that they might be able to carry out operations in JavaScript, node JS and other state-of-the- art systems that take advantage of the open-source ecosystem. Soothing APIs are also in the pipeline with information deliverance to both SaaS (software as a service) and enterprise application software. All these big promises make it look as if <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/lotus-notes/">Lotus Notes</a> will be perfectly in tune with contemporaneity instead of simply tending to be a forward leap.</p>
<p>However that quantum jump to modernity is not happening anytime now and will have to wait till the version 11 of Notes is released. Version 11 has all the trappings of a modern-day application software-artificial intelligence, analytics, and machine-learning framework and interface. Spokespersons of IBM notified about database innovation-the Notes Storage Facility (NSF) database which was regarded as the authentic NoSQL database were considered amenable for innovation. Users have also been given word that they may be able to witness more specifics of Notes 10 in the upcoming IBM Think Conference that was scheduled to be held in the US. The users will also be kept informed about further revelations throughout the year. Although a release or launch date for the Notes 10 is yet to be finalized and/or announced, users in a webinar were requested to offer their opinion on the Q3 releases.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="alignleft wp-image-1616 size-medium" title="Improve Your Business with the latest Advanced Business Intelligence Tools" src="https://www.ibsi-us.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/03/Improve-Your-Business-with-the-latest-Advanced-Business-Intelligence-Tools-450x450.jpg" alt="Top Business Intelligence (BI) tools in the market" width="450" height="450" />Even though machine learning and Artificial Intelligence might be the trending topic these days, business intelligence(BI) is still a reliable tool for many <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/small-business/">businesses</a> especially when it comes to decision making. Companies across the world rely on analytics and BI to gain more insights about the market data. Whether you are looking for these great tools or just a quick and easy way to track your business, there are several BI systems you can choose.</p>
<p><strong>Factors to consider</strong></p>
<p>The type of BI platform you select depends on your needs, and there are some few important factors to take into consideration.<br />
There is always no need to have a robust Business intelligence solution if it’s unable to interact with your business data, whether it’s accounting transactions, SQL database or details from the Customer relationship management system.</p>
<p>Nearly all best BI systems support a different array of data sources, and they are unique in the way they gather that information and keep it updated. Besides, the tools provide advanced features including real-time analytics of live data and predictive analytics for determining future trends.</p>
<p>The primary value of a BI system lies in the way the dashboard allows you to visualize the data with accessible formats such as charts, and interact with the same data to break it down into a smaller form. Lastly, one should find out if the application is self-service. How everyday users find it easy to gather and visualize data without the assistance of data scientists.</p>
<p><strong>Popular Business Intelligence Applications</strong></p>
<p><strong>Qlik</strong></p>
<p>Qlik is among the best BI providers. Qlik Sense is a self-service app that eases everything for everyday business users to analyze, visualize and discover a wide range of data. The company offers more powerful analytics tool, comprehensive Qlik Analytics Platform, and <a target="_blank"   rel="noopener external nofollow"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Qlik">QlikView</a> or enterprises. You can get QlikView and Qlik Sense both as cloud and desktop <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/apps/">applications</a>. If you are looking for a personalized version of Qlik, it’s free while the commercial version of Qlik is priced high.</p>
<p><strong>Tableau</strong></p>
<p>It’s among the original self-service BI applications. <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2018/02/prefer-tableau-gain-insights/">Tableau</a> has set the standard as one of the most influential tools that offer various ways to visualize and analyze data formats. Also, it features advanced real-time and predictive analytics. While its interface is quite intuitive, it’s not that easy to learn compared to Power BI.<br />
Tableau is available both as a desktop application for Windows and Mac. Its price is high, but you can be sure of a great BI tool.</p>
<p><strong>Microsoft Power BI</strong></p>
<p>Before the launch of Power Bi, many organizations used Excel to analyze and process data. Until today some organizations still use Excel, Power BI came to life as an Excel add-on before it evolved into a powerful and easy to learn self-service Business Intelligence system.<br />
Power BI offers support to many data formats, but its strengths lie in how it integrates with the <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/category/microsoft/">Microsoft</a> products like <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2017/09/microsoft-office-365-is-essential/">Office 365</a>. Power BI is available for free as a standard version, and the Pro version comes with extra features at an affordable price.</p>
<p><strong>Other Available options</strong></p>
<p>While Power BI, Qlik, and Tableau are the popular BI options in the market, there are other options available too.</p>
<p><strong>IBM</strong></p>
<p><a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/our-services/ibm-lotus-foundations/">IBM</a> released the cloud-based Watson Analytics to its traditional products like Cognos.</p>
<p><strong>Oracle</strong></p>
<p><a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2011/01/ken-moore-leaves-for-oracle/">Oracle</a> has one of the most powerful data visualizations and business intelligence tools popular with organizations that have Oracle enterprise software.</p>
<p><strong>Salesforce</strong></p>
<p>Besides having a good customer relationship management, Salesforce provides BI tools.</p>
<p><strong>SAP</strong></p>
<p>Business organizations that use SAP’s enterprise resource can benefit with the SAP analytics <a href="https://www.ibsi-us.com/2016/11/innovative-business-technology-why-cloud-based-email/">Cloud-based</a> and self-service app.<br />
